2013-01-08 95 views
0

我有一個相當簡單的設置:處理表單中多個關聯模型的最佳方法?

型號/ person.rb

has_many :links 

型號/ link_category.rb

attr_accessible :title 
has_many :links 

型號/ links.rb

attr_accessible :person_id, :link_category_id, :url 
belongs_to :person 
belongs_to :link_category 

鏈接類別的例子可能是像「臉譜,微博,pinterest,wordpress,博客等」。

我想創建的內容,儘可能DRY和RESTful,是一個單獨的頁面,列出了所有的鏈接類別和文本字段,供他們輸入(或更新,如果已經提供)每個類別的網址。

例如,像這樣http://example.com/person/23/links/edit可能會顯示這樣的形式:

Facebook的:_ __ _ __ _ __ _ __ _ __ _ __ _ _

推特:__ http://twitter.com/example_ _

的WordPress:_ __ _ __ _ __ _ __ _ __ _ __ _

Pinterest的:_ __ _ __ _ __ _ __ _ __ _ __ _

我想知道如果任何人有這樣的一種優雅的方式,因爲它已經成爲相當普遍的數的網站。

回答

相關問題